华为云国际站代理商注册及配置FTP服务器登录到Web服务器的详细步骤可以按照以下流程进行:
第一步:注册成为华为云国际站代理商
- 访问华为云官方网页。
- 寻找“合作伙伴”或“代理商”注册部分。
- 按照网站指引填写必要信息,包括公司信息、联系方式等。
- 提交申请并等待审核。
第二步:创建和配置FTP服务器
创建服务器
- 登录华为云控制台。
- 选择“弹性云服务器 ECS”。
- 点击创建云服务器,选择合适的配置和镜像,比如可以选择一个预装了FTP服务的操作系统镜像,例如Ubuntu。
- 设置网络、安全组等,确保安全组开放了FTP使用的端口(通常为21)。
- 启动服务器。
配置FTP服务(以Linux系统为例)
- 连接到服务器(使用SSH或其他远程连接工具)。
-
安装FTP服务器软件,如vsftpd:
sudo apt update sudo apt install vsftpd
-
编辑FTP配置文件:
sudo nano /etc/vsftpd.conf
-
确保配置文件中启用了需要的选项,例如:
anonymous_enable=NO
local_enable=YES
write_enable=YES
- 其他根据需要调整的设置。
-
重新启动FTP服务:
sudo systemctl restart vsftpd
第三步:配置Web服务器与FTP服务器交互
- 假设你已有一个运行中的Web服务器,确保这个服务器可以访问FTP服务器(在同一网络或安全组规则允许互相访问)。
-
在Web服务器上配置FTP客户端或使用编程方式访问FTP服务。例如,如果是PHP服务器,可以使用PHP的FTP功能:
$ftp_server = "FTP服务器地址"; $ftp_conn = ftp_connect($ftp_server) or die("Could not connect to $ftp_server"); $login = ftp_login($ftp_conn, "username", "password"); if ($login) { echo "连接成功"; // 这里可以添加更多的FTP操作,如ftp_get, ftp_put等 } else { echo "登录失败"; } ftp_close($ftp_conn);
注意事项
- 确保处理好安全设置,特别是不要在生产环境中使用FTP的匿名访问。
- FTP协议本身不加密数据,如果安全性是一个考虑,建议使用SFTP或FTPS。
- 检查网络设置和防火墙规则,确保相关端口(如21端口)开放。
以上步骤提供了如何成为华为云国际站代理商,并在其上创建与配置FTP服务器与Web服务器间的基本连接和数据传输指令。如果有特异性需求或遇到问题,可能还需要参考具体的文档或寻求技术支持。
发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/178943.html